Market Dynamics of Japan Electric Parallel Gripper Market

The Japanese market for electric parallel grippers is characterized by a mature yet innovation-driven environment. The industry benefits from Japan’s advanced manufacturing infrastructure, high standards for precision, and a strong culture of robotics integration. The adoption of electric grippers over pneumatic alternatives is accelerating due to their energy efficiency, enhanced control, and integration capabilities with Industry 4.0 systems. This shift is supported by government initiatives promoting smart manufacturing and Industry 4.0 adoption, which incentivize automation upgrades across sectors.

Technological advancements such as miniaturization, increased payload capacity, and smart sensing are transforming the competitive landscape. The industry is witnessing a convergence of robotics, AI, and IoT, enabling more adaptive and intelligent gripping solutions. Despite high market maturity, growth opportunities persist in niche applications like medical robotics, food handling, and hazardous environment operations. Supply chain resilience and component innovation remain critical success factors, especially amid geopolitical uncertainties affecting global component sourcing.
